    Here is a .zip with the Netbeui files for anyone interested. All you need to do is place the .inf in Windows\inf and the .sys in Windows\system32\drivers.

    http://rapidshare.com/files/24043533...Files.zip.html

    Then disable Netbios in the ip settings screen for the adapter and then add the protocol as per screenshot. Do this for each machine on the network. A plus is that it is also more secure.
